A couple of months ago, Xiaomi announced its latest HyperCharge fast charging solutions, showcasing what to expect from its smartphones in the future. It introduced 200W wired charging technology and 120W wireless charging technology.

Recently, it was reported that the Xiaomi HyperCharge technology could go into mass production by June 2022 and feature in a smartphone the same year. Now, a new report also indicates the 200W fast charging technology to enter mass production next year.

Xiaomi HyperCharge 200W Charging

What’s interesting is that the report claims that the Xiaomi Mi MIX 5 smartphone will be the first one to get support for 200W fast wired charging and hints that the device could get launched next year. It also adds that the phone may not have support for 120W fast wireless charging technology but come with 50W wireless charging.

The report claims that Xiaomi has two flagship lineups where the primary series focuses on offering top performance and display, along with better camera configuration. On the other hand, the Mi MIX series comes with experimental technology, offering innovative solutions when it comes to display, phone material, and charging.

The newly launched Mi MIX 4 comes with 120W wired charging support, which was introduced along with Mi 10 Ultra smartphone last year as is still among the fastest charging solution available for a smartphone. But this year’s flagship, Mi 11 Ultra is limited to 67W fast charging. Because of this, it is being speculated that the 200W fast charging solution will be made available on the Mi MIX 5 smartphone.

The Xiaomi HyperCharge 200W wired charging solution can charge a 4,000mAh battery to 50 percent capacity in just three minutes. And it takes just eight minutes to gain 100 percent battery juice. On the other hand, the 120W wireless charging can charge a 4,000mAh battery to 10 percent in just 1 minute, 50 percent in 7 minutes, and 100 percent in only 15 minutes.
